We got sheet metal for our build. There is a cool story with this one. When I found our 66 Charger I knew it needed a drivers side quarter panel and the channel behind it. I located a donor half car but it was sold before I could get to it. 6-7 months later I located the same half car for sale again. The guy that had it even delivered it to my house for a reasonable price. When he got to my house I had a BBQ lunch waiting as a thanks. Now we can pull the trigger on this bad boy. I hope to have it completed some time in summer along with our 67 Coronet. The Mopar gods have been good to us. Now it's time for my son to drill out some spot welds.

It wasn't on the curb for long. My son stripped it down and we put it in the driveway. I found the Vin tag from the door jamb. We ran it through the DMV and it was clear. My son will be drilling out the spot welds this weekend. Now to find a roof skin for my 68 Dart. Got to love rust free metal especially when it's local.
